How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Kirkwood?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Kirkwood Studio Apartments | $1,447 | $899 | $1,852 |
Kirkwood 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,762 | $790 | $3,075 |
Kirkwood 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,014 | $830 | $4,030 |
Kirkwood 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,121 | $850 | $4,150 |
Kirkwood 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,043 | $1,624 | $3,300 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Kirkwood
How much are Studio apartments in Kirkwood?
There are currently 6 Studio Apartments in Kirkwood with rent ranges from $899 to $1,852 with an average price of $1,447.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Kirkwood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Kirkwood ranges from $790 to $3,075 with an average monthly rent of $1,762.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Kirkwood c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Kirkwood range from $830 to $4,030.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,014.
How expensive are Kirkwood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 15 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Kirkwood on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$850 to $4,150 - averaging $2,121 for the location.
